This week on Pastors Unfiltered, Pastor Tony is joined by Pastor Christian Lindbeck in a raw, deep-dive conversation about healing from shame, confronting past wounds, and finding true peace through Jesus. From cinematic commentary on Thunderbolts and Severance to vulnerable personal stories of spiritual warfare, confession, and restoration, this episode is one of the most powerful yet.
